When: 25 November 2017
Where: Sir John Deane's College, Monarch Drive, Northwich, Cheshire. CW9 8AF
Time: 10am-4pm
Description: Part 1 is on 11 November 2017
The course will follow on from the beginners Saturday course. This is a chance to delve deeper into the lives of your ancestors. Were they a war hero, did they travel abroad or did they find themselves in court or even in the workhouse?
Many of the resources we look at are free but you will need a debit/credit card to buy online credits for some sites.
